Choosing The Right Horse Rugs

Just like people horses need comfort too. They need somewhere to sit that makes them feel comfortable and something warm in their stable. This is why it is important to choose the right horse rugs to suit your horse.

The first thing to check is that what they wear fits. This may sound obvious but it is not necessarily something that is immediately obvious when you order something online and it arrives in your home. Therefore you need to check it against your horse so that you can gauge whether or not it is an appropriate fit.

First of all you need to measure your horse. You need to measure from the centre of the chest and along the side. This will then give you a guide to the size that the rug needs to be and should ensure the best possible fit. You can then order something that should be the right fit by checking product specifications before you purchase something.

Each rug comes in a set size. They tend to come in three inch increments. Therefore you have to decide whether or not you want to add a little extra material in order to make them a bit more comfortable or not. Ultimately this depends on the animal as some may prefer more material and others may not.

Each size comes in 3 inch increments. Therefore you need to think whether you want to give a couple of extra inches to provide a bit more warmth. It is not always easy to gauge but it is likely that it is better for the horse to give a bit more warmth for them than less.

The half neck provides a bit more warmth than the standard. Another advantage that the half has over the standard is that it lets less rainwater in. The full neck is best suited to animals that are very sensitive to cold, have been clipped or older horses that have become more sensitive to the cold in their older age. There is also the additional advantage that you do not have to clean the neck with a full cover.

Fill is also an issue. A lighter weighted rug is best suited to younger horses and those that are less sensitive to cold. A more sensitive or older animal is more likely to need a heavier weighted one. It may also be worth having one for the summer as well as the winter so you can always have something appropriate for your horse.
